About the Role
The CAPA Manager is responsible for independently managing and coordinating the corrective and preventive action (CAPA) processes within the organization. This role is pivotal in handling quality issues, customer complaints, and production deviations, with the goal of maintaining and improving the quality management system through effective problem-solving and cross-functional collaboration.
